Comparative Analysis: Traditional vs. Modern Methodologies

Traditionally, creating body waves entailed a step-by-step approach: sectioning hair into uniform parts, employing heated curling rods or irons, setting each section carefully, and allowing sufficient cooling before styling. The process was labor-intensive, required significant manual dexterity, and was heavily dependent on the stylist’s experience to prevent damage and ensure uniformity. The core advantage was the control it offered, allowing for customized wave patterns; however, the drawbacks—time consumption and risk of heat damage—had become increasingly problematic as clients and professionals demanded faster results.

Modern techniques leverage advancements in ergonomically designed tools, innovative product chemistry, and streamlined workflows intended to expedite each phase. For example, ceramic and tourmaline-infused curling irons with adjustable temperature controls heat uniformly and reduce styling time. Additionally, the advent of pre-set styling products, such as wave-enhancing mousses and sprays, facilitate quicker setting and hold, reducing the need for prolonged blow-drying or multiple passes with styling tools.

Contrasts and Limitations: Speed Versus Hair Health and Style Longevity

While rapid styling techniques offer tangible benefits, they also present specific trade-offs that must be examined through a balanced lens. The juxtaposition of traditional, slower methods with fast-paced approaches highlights these important considerations.

Preservation of Hair Integrity

Prolonged heat exposure, a common concern with rapid styling, risks cumulative damage manifesting as dryness, breakage, and loss of natural shine. Traditional methods, when performed with meticulous control and longer cooling times, often distribute heat more evenly, reducing hot spots that exacerbate damage. Conversely, fast techniques that rely on higher initial temperatures or rapid application may inadvertently increase stress on the hair cuticle unless adequately protected by quality heat protectants and tension control. Evidence suggests that using tools with ceramic or tourmaline surfaces and employing lower temperature settings, coupled with pre-application of protective styling agents, can mitigate these risks even within shortened timeframes.

Style Longevity and Client Satisfaction

While speed enhances throughput, the durability of body waves remains a critical measure of success. The slower, more deliberate traditional technique often yields longer-lasting results due to thorough setting, proper cooling, and careful tension. Rapid methods, if not executed mindfully, may result in shorter-lived waves, necessitating more frequent touch-ups. This scenario emphasizes the importance of selecting the right products, employing correct tensioning, and ensuring adequate cooling—elements that, if overlooked in pursuit of efficiency, undermine client satisfaction.

Integrating Speed Optimization into Your Styling Routine

Implementing rapid styling practices requires strategic planning and skill refinement. Here are practical steps to transition from traditional to accelerated body wave styling:

  1. Upgrade your tools: Invest in high-quality, multi-functional heat styling devices with fast heat-up times and precise temperature controls.
  2. Refine your product selection: Use heat-activated, quick-setting styling products that promote hold and resilience in less time.
  3. Master tension management: Practice consistent tension during wrapping or curling to ensure uniform wave formation and reduce the need for correction and re-styling.
  4. Implement cooling techniques: Use cool air blasts or wait periods to set the style rapidly, increasing durability even in quick processes.
  5. Develop a workflow: Create a step-by-step routine that minimizes unnecessary repetition and maximizes efficiency, such as pre-sectioning hair for faster handling.
